Job description

Join our dynamic team and become a critical guardian of technological infrastructure. As a Data Center Engineering Technician, you will play a pivotal role in maintaining mission‑critical technology infrastructure, ensuring seamless operations and delivering an extraordinary 99.999% uptime.

Key Responsibilities
  • Daily building rounds to monitor and record information from electrical, mechanical, and fire/life safety equipment to ensure 24/7 reliability and availability.
  • Monitor Building Management Systems (BMS) and Electrical Power Management System (EPMS).
  • Assist in troubleshooting facility and rack‑level events within internal Service Level Agreements (SLA).
  • Perform rack installs and rack decommissioning within internal SLA.
  • Perform preventive maintenance, troubleshooting, root cause analysis, and repair of electrical and mechanical equipment.
  • Produce technical writing to support the change management program.
  • Monitor daily work requests, manage resolution, and execute projects from conception to completion.
  • Provide on‑site support of contractors, subcontractors, and vendors, ensuring all work follows established practices, procedures, and local legislation.
  • Adapt to work schedule changes as needed; shifts may be up to 12 hours and may rotate on a predefined schedule. Some locations have on‑call rotations.
  • Support more than one location or site if required.

A Day in the Life

This role acts as Amazon’s front line for hands‑on electrical and mechanical equipment preventative maintenance (PM) and troubleshooting, reporting to a site’s Data Center Facility Manager (FM). You will maintain, operate, and troubleshoot mission‑critical data center facility equipment including standby diesel generators, fuel systems, three‑phase electrical systems such as switchgear, UPS units, PDUs, and wet cell batteries, as well as mechanical equipment such as CRAHU units, centrifugal chillers, cooling towers, water systems, air handlers, pumps, and motors. Additional support equipment includes fire/life safety equipment, building automation systems, and general facilities equipment.
